<a href="http://www.bmwfilms.com">http://www.bmwfilms.com</a><br /><br />The commercials known as "The Hire" from BMW Films, featuring Clive Owen, will be taken down after October 21, 2005. I guess the right to distribute the content from the original actors at a cost effective price is ending.<br /><br /><img src="http://www.pocketpcthoughts.com/images/hansberry/2005/20051017-thehire.jpg" /><br /><br />I think most films are available in the 320X240 Pocket PC format, which brings up a question. How do these look on a VGA device? The same, or is it only half the screen, or worse, does it pixel double like Pocket IE does with images? 8O Anyway, if you want the films, download them now, or better yet, order the DVD. I did that last summer. It was free. I only paid shipping and handling. Not sure if it is free to residents of all countries though.

I think most films are available in the 320X240 Pocket PC format, which brings up a question. How do these look on a VGA device? The same, or is it only half the screen, or worse, does it pixel double like Pocket IE does with images?

I haven't tried these particular media files, but 240 x 320 WMVs I've sampled in the past pixel double in Windows Media Player. You'll certainly get by without shedding a tear, but once you harness the full power of the VGA screen by playing back 480 x 640 videos, you'll never even bother with 240 x 320 and its pixel doubling again.
